Leo: The Square changes
I'm pleased to announce a significant milestone in the game development process. I've completed the creation of the first ten levels! It's been a long and intensive process, full of trials and creative solutions.
My friends have started testing the levels, and I'm happy to report they are satisfied with what they see. Their feedback helps to improve the gaming experience and make each level even more engaging. This is important because I aim to create a game that brings enjoyment and challenge to players.
The experience gained from working on these levels will be valuable for future development. The process typically involved starting each level with sketches on paper, translating ideas into the game engine editor. This process allows me to experiment with various arrangements of blocks, lighting, particle effects, and mechanics to achieve the desired gaming atmosphere.
My main task now is to refine the levels based on feedback and prepare them for the next stage of development. And of course, to continue creating new levels. I anticipate having around 30 or 40 levels in total by the end. I am particularly motivated to continue development, especially now that I can see the levels taking shape.
